For web developers and designers, it is becoming increasingly difficult to keep up with the myriad of devices being used to access the internet. There are mobile phones, smartphones, tablets, ultrabooks and desktops – all of which have different screen sizes and resolutions. In such a scenario, creating the perfect website which looks good on all platforms can be a tough job. Responsive web design makes things easier by fitting into any screen resolution.
